Since I switched to Ubuntu 9.10 I have the Gnome Network Manager showing a 
signal strength of 2/4, while it was 4/4 on Ubuntu 9.04. Also iwconfig says 
40/100.
I'm not close enough to the router to have a full field, but I'm sure that 
should be quite close to it (at least 80/100).
I'm using an USB wifi dongle with zd1211 chipset:

[   16.467798] zd1211rw 1-1:1.0: zd1211 chip 0ace:1211 v4802 high
00-02-72 AL2230_RF pa0 -----

I'm not sure this is related to the same bug.
